Pack 40 Cub Scouts in Quincy

Cub Scout Pack 40 has been around for many years. Just like any activity, it has its ups and downs. We currently have around 15 boys and are in a rebuilding stage. We have a good number of active parents and boys and are looking to do more as we grow and learn more about the program and get more training.

St Paul Lutheran Church here in Quincy is our Sponsor and we meet there.

Sunday, December 9, 2007

Food Drive w/Firefighters 12-9-07



Today, the Cubs and the Volunteer Firefighters went around town with Santa and collected food for our local Food Bank. We had about 8 boys and their parents, as well as about 8-10 Firefighters driving some engines and "chase" rigs with the food in back. The boys all got to ride on the Fire Trucks and they also walked around with Santa collecting food. They all seemed to have a good time.



Pinewood Derby - 11-11-07



So after 4 weeks of meetings and building the cars together, we finally get to race day. Out of 14 boys registered at the time...we had 12 race and 2 siblings also. We borrowed a computerized track from a friend of scouts, and set up the track at the Jr. High gym. We had a great time and it was surprisingly quick. Pack 40 Joining Nights


The first few Joining Nights were spent on building the Pinewood Derby Cars and getting ready for our first Pack Activity, which was the Derby. The boys met at one of the Schools here in Quincy and worked on Cutting and Sanding one night...the following week they worked on Painting, and Finally on Nov. 11, 2007 we had our race.
